Understanding the Core Mechanics
At its heart, the mines game presents a grid of squares, concealing either prizes or mines. The player’s objective is to navigate this grid, selecting squares one by one, hoping to reveal a prize without triggering a mine. With each successful pick, the potential payout increases. But proceed with caution: landing on a mine instantly forfeits your current bet. The size of the grid, and consequently the number of mines, can often be customized, allowing players to tailor the difficulty to their preference.
The level of risk a player assumes dictates the potential reward. A larger grid with fewer mines offers a safer, albeit less lucrative, experience. Conversely, a smaller grid packed with mines promises a substantial payout but carries a significantly higher risk of triggering a losing square. Mastering the art of balancing risk and reward is paramount to success in this captivating game.

Auto-Cashout Features and Their Implications
One prevalent feature found in many modern iterations of the mines game is the auto-cashout option. This function allows players to set a predetermined multiplier at which the game will automatically cash out their winnings. This greatly simplifies the process of securing profits, eliminating the need for manual intervention at a critical moment. The auto-cashout feature can be extremely useful for players who prefer a more hands-off approach or who are prone to making impulsive decisions under pressure. However, it does come with its own set of considerations.
Setting the auto-cashout point too low, for example, may result in missing out on a potentially much larger payout. Conversely, setting it too high increases the risk of triggering a mine before the cashout is activated. Finding the sweet spot requires careful consideration of your risk tolerance, the game’s volatility, and your overall goals. It’s often advisable to start with a conservative auto-cashout point and gradually increase it as you gain experience and confidence.
The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
The fairness and integrity of any online casino game, including the mines game, hinge on the use of a reliable Random Number Generator (RNG). An RNG is a sophisticated algorithm that produces a sequence of numbers entirely based on chance. This ensures that each spin, each card dealt, and each square revealed is independent and unbiased. Trusted online platforms employ RNGs that are rigorously tested and certified by independent auditing firms.
These auditing firms verify that the RNG is functioning correctly and that the game’s payout percentages are in line with the advertised rates. It’s vital to only play at online casinos that are licensed and regulated by reputable authorities. These licenses provide a level of assurance that the platform operates ethically and responsibly, with a commitment to player fairness and security. A certificate of RNG testing is often prominently displayed on the website.
